Sulfuric acid is classified as a strong acid; in aqueous solutions it ionizes completely to form hydronium (H3O ) and hydrogensulfate (HSO−4) ions. In other words, the sulfuric acid behaves as a Brønsted–Lowry acid and is deprotonated to form hydrogensulfate ion. Hydrogensulfate has a valency of 1.
